One-component silicone-based elastic adhesive "Sekisui Bond #75"

Formaldehyde emission rate below 5 μg/m²h! It does not corrode metals, making it suitable for construction applications.

"Sekisui Bond #75" is an adhesive recommended by Sekisui for flooring and interior construction, taking health and environmental considerations into account. It is a multipurpose type that maintains high elasticity, is resistant to impact and vibration, absorbs the stress of expansion and contraction between adhered materials, and boasts excellent durability. Additionally, it can be easily removed from unnecessary areas such as the surface of the floor. It is easy to extrude even in winter, providing good workability. 【Features】 ■ Non-formaldehyde product compliant with building standards ■ JAIA F☆☆☆☆ certified ■ Low odor and does not corrode metals ■ Can be used as an adhesive in conjunction with double-sided tape ■ High viscosity mastic type *For more details, please feel free to contact us.

Heat-resistant adhesive | Ceramic adhesive (inorganic) Ceramabond 503

Alumina base. The coefficient of expansion is small, making it commonly used for bonding ceramics. It is also suitable for bonding materials such as platinum.

Alemco manufactured, based on alumina. It is a water-soluble inorganic heat-resistant adhesive. It is commonly used for bonding and sealing thermocouple deep probes used in high-temperature ranges. Being inert and chemically resistant, it does not outgas even in high vacuum conditions. Additionally, it has excellent insulation properties, with an insulation strength of 171 volts/mil (at room temperature). The heat resistance limit is 1,650°C.

Heat-resistant adhesive | Ceramic adhesive (inorganic) Ceramabond 552

Alemco manufactured, alumina-based. Suitable for bonding metals with low expansion coefficients such as molybdenum and tungsten, as well as ceramics and glass.

It is a one-component adhesive with alumina as the main filler. It is a high-temperature ceramic adhesive used for bonding soldering gun tips and electrical/mechanical assembly parts that require high heat resistance. The heat resistance limit is 1650°C.

Heat-resistant adhesive | Ceramic adhesive (inorganic) Ceramabond 569

Alumina base. Can be processed at room temperature and is widely used for bonding and coating between ceramics and between ceramics and metals, as well as for preventing screw loosening.

This is a new type of heat-resistant ceramic adhesive made by Alemco, based on alumina. It is a completely inorganic, one-component white paste that is widely used for bonding ceramics, metals, and quartz. It does not contain sodium and does not require heat curing. It can be processed at room temperature. It is ideal for bonding ceramics to each other and for bonding ceramics to metals, such as sensors. The heat resistance limit is 1650°C.

Heat-resistant adhesive | Ceramic adhesive (inorganic) Ultra Temp 516

Based on zirconia, the heat resistance limit is the highest among ceramic adhesives at 1760°C. It is a product with excellent insulation and adhesion properties.

Alemco's "Zirconia-based" ultra-high temperature ceramic adhesive. It is a new type of inorganic ceramic adhesive based on zirconia, used for sensors and equipment that operate at high temperatures. The heat resistance limit reaches an impressive 1760°C, the highest for ceramic adhesives. It exhibits excellent electrical, mechanical, and thermal properties. Being water-soluble, it can be easily removed with warm water and soap before curing.

Heat-resistant adhesive | Ceramic adhesive (inorganic) Ceramabond 668

Based on alumina and silica. Can be processed at room temperature. Between ceramics and between ceramics and metals. Used for bonding and encapsulating small electronic components.

Manufactured by Alemco, it is based on alumina and silica. It is a one-component adhesive that demonstrates excellent effectiveness in bonding ceramics and metals (such as steel and stainless steel). Additionally, it is used for bonding and encapsulating small electrical components like resistors, ignition devices, temperature sensing probes, and halogen lamps. After application, it should be air-dried at room temperature for about one hour, followed by firing at 93°C for 2 to 4 hours. The heat resistance limit is 1,371°C.

Heat-resistant adhesive | Ceramic adhesive (inorganic) Ceramabond 618N

It features a silica base, a small thermal expansion coefficient, and strong adhesion. It is suitable for bonding ceramics, glass, and quartz.

Aremco's products demonstrate strong adhesion to silica-based materials, including low-expansion coefficient molybdenum and tungsten metals, as well as ceramics, quartz, and glass. After application, allow to air dry at room temperature for 1 to 4 hours, then fire in stages at 93°C for 2 hours, 260°C for 2 hours, and 370°C for 2 hours to achieve complete curing. The maximum heat resistance is 1,650°C.

Heat-resistant adhesive | Ceramic adhesive (inorganic) Ceramabond 835

Zirconium base, reinforced with ceramic fibers. For bonding ceramics to ceramics and ceramics to metals. An example of use is halogen lamps.

Alemco product, zirconia-based. It is a water-soluble one-component type that adheres well to ceramics, glass, and metals. Reinforced with ceramic fibers, it can be processed at room temperature. It is used for bonding ceramics to ceramics and ceramics to metals. Mainly used during the production of halogen lamps. After application, allow it to dry for about one hour, then it will cure after firing at 93°C for two hours. The heat resistance limit is 1,371°C.

Heat-resistant adhesive | Ceramic adhesive (inorganic) Ceramabond 865

Based on aluminum nitride, it has high thermal conductivity and is insulating. It is used for sensors that require thermal conductivity, as well as for bonding ceramics to metals and ceramics to ceramics.

Alemco manufactured, aluminum nitride base. For bonding ceramics and metals such as ceramics, metals, semiconductors, and sensors that require high heat resistance and high thermal conductivity. After drying at room temperature for 1 to 4 hours, it is fired in stages at 93°C for 2 hours, 177°C for 2 hours, and 260°C for 2 hours. Heat resistance limit: 1,650°C.

Heat-resistant adhesive | Ceramic adhesive (inorganic) Ceramabond 835M

Alumina-based with very strong adhesive properties and insulating characteristics. For bonding ceramics to ceramics and ceramics to metals. An example of use is halogen lamps.

Alemco product, alumina-based. It is a water-soluble one-component type that adheres well to ceramics, glass, and metals. It is ideal for use with automatic dispensers. Mainly used during the production of halogen lamps. After application, allow to dry for about 1 to 4 hours, then cure at 93°C for 2 hours. The heat resistance limit is 1,650°C.

Cold Welding/Structural Adhesive Belsona 7311 Catalog

Structural adhesives with excellent fatigue resistance are ideal alternatives to mechanical fastening, securing, and welding.

This structural adhesive, which requires high mechanical strength (resistance to shear and tear loads), is ideal for bonding applications where periodic and semi-permanent loads are applied to structures. It can be used as an alternative to mechanical fastening, fixing, and welding, and has heat resistance up to 60°C without the need for the following. It also has the following features: - Excellent adhesion to metal substrates - Engineering design data package - Solvent-free - Optimal temperature range of -30°C to 60°C - No special tools required - No flame required
